Usripani Population - Raipur, Chhattisgarh

Usripani is a medium size village located in Deobhog Tehsil of Raipur district, Chhattisgarh with total 178 families residing. The Usripani village has population of 630 of which 310 are males while 320 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Usripani village population of children with age 0-6 is 103 which makes up 16.35 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Usripani village is 1032 which is higher than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Usripani as per census is 1512, higher than Chhattisgarh average of 969.

Usripani village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Usripani village was 58.82 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Usripani Male literacy stands at 76.95 % while female literacy rate was 39.92 %.

Caste Factor

In Usripani village, most of the village population is from Schedule Tribe (ST).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 80.95 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 1.90 % of total population in Usripani village.

Work Profile

In Usripani village out of total population, 406 were engaged in work activities. 8.87 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 91.13 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 406 workers engaged in Main Work, 6 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 1 were Agricultural labourer.
